For Americans, the right to vote is the result of many hard fought victories championed by brave individuals of our past. Yet, these days so few of us exercise this right.
Voting is the extension of your voice. It enables you to speak out - to determine who will represent you as your elected officials and work to protect and preserve your best interests, as well as the best interests of your children. Your informed vote empowers you to elect public servants who share your hopes and dreams and ensure that your tax dollars are used to produce measured results.
|
The fact is, more of us need to exercise this right. San Bernardino County's voter registration rate is among the lowest in the state; and the outcomes of many of our federal, state and local elections are determined by very small percentages of our County's eligible voters.
It is true – as stated in this issue’s article “Yes! Your Vote Matters” – every vote counts. I encourage everyone to learn about the candidates campaigning to represent your community and determine if their values and priorities align with yours. Then exercise your right. It's time for you to be heard!
